Hao Chang (常皓)

Pyraminx · top 4.3% of 129,321 all-time · competing since November 2015 · 2015CHAN33

Hao Chang (常皓) has been competing for 11 years. Her best event is the Pyraminx: a personal-best single of 3.18, set at Inner Mongolia Winter 2018, puts her in the top 4.3% of the 129,321 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 513th in China. Until February 2008, no official Pyraminx solve in the world had been that fast. Across 43 competitions since November 2015, she has put 646 official solves on the record across 13 events. Solve to solve, her 3×3 times vary about 13% around a typical one; 59%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ds hold a tighter spread. Her Pyraminx best has come down from 6.44 in October 2016 to 3.18, a 51% improvement. Hao has entered 43 competitions, more competitions than 99%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
